Be very careful with the muffler idea. I would NOT do this. If you want quiet run it into the DP. Any restriction on the flow of the exhaust gasses leaving the wastegate can cause boost creep. If the muffler gets corroded or dirty with fuel and carbon over time it will become more and more restrictive. Till one day you boost 35 psi and pop one or more pistons.

If you do use a muffler, then run a boost cut switch for sure. Better safe then sorry IMO.

I was worried when i first started it up after priming the oil pressure. For the first five minutes or so i had a really bad lifter tick. I took a while to pump up but after a few minutes and racing the engine a few times it went away. However i did run into a problem. I purchased a v-band clamp and flanges from a friend and it turns out that they are no good. Even with the clamp tight there is about a 1/64" gap between the two. It is not warped or anything so i dont know whats up with that. I can hear and feel the leak, because of this i can trust my wideband to read the proper afr. To swap another in would be a pain in the *** so i am going to try to make a gasket for it. I hope he will atleast pay for the gasket material since he sold me a bad part.
